ContentResolver.Update Metodo

Definizione

Overload

Update(Uri, ContentValues, Bundle)

Aggiornare le righe in un URI del contenuto.

Update(Uri, ContentValues, String, String[])

Aggiornare le righe in un URI del contenuto.

Update(Uri, ContentValues, Bundle)

Aggiornare le righe in un URI del contenuto.

[Android.Runtime.Register("update", "(Landroid/net/Uri;Landroid/content/ContentValues;Landroid/os/Bundle;)I", "", ApiSince=30)]
public int Update (Android.Net.Uri uri, Android.Content.ContentValues? values, Android.OS.Bundle? extras);
[<Android.Runtime.Register("update", "(Landroid/net/Uri;Landroid/content/ContentValues;Landroid/os/Bundle;)I", "", ApiSince=30)>]
member this.Update : Android.Net.Uri * Android.Content.ContentValues * Android.OS.Bundle -> int

Parametri

uri
Uri

URI da modificare.

values
ContentValues

I nuovi valori di campo. La chiave è il nome della colonna per il campo. Un valore Null rimuoverà un valore di campo esistente.

extras
Bundle

Bundle contenente informazioni aggiuntive necessarie per l'operazione. Gli argomenti possono includere argomenti di stile SQL, ad esempio ContentResolver#QUERY_ARG_SQL_LIMIT, ma si noti che la documentazione per ogni singolo provider indicherà quali argomenti supportano.

Restituisce

numero di righe aggiornate.

Attributi

Commenti

Aggiornare le righe in un URI del contenuto.

Se il provider di contenuto supporta le transazioni, l'aggiornamento sarà atomico.

Documentazione Java per android.content.ContentResolver.update(android.net.Uri, android.content.ContentValues, android.os.Bundle).

Le parti di questa pagina sono modifiche in base al lavoro creato e condiviso dal Android Open Source e usato in base ai termini descritti nella .

Si applica a

Update(Uri, ContentValues, String, String[])

Aggiornare le righe in un URI del contenuto.

[Android.Runtime.Register("update", "(Landroid/net/Uri;Landroid/content/ContentValues;Ljava/lang/String;[Ljava/lang/String;)I", "")]
public int Update (Android.Net.Uri uri, Android.Content.ContentValues? values, string? where, string[]? selectionArgs);
[<Android.Runtime.Register("update", "(Landroid/net/Uri;Landroid/content/ContentValues;Ljava/lang/String;[Ljava/lang/String;)I", "")>]
member this.Update : Android.Net.Uri * Android.Content.ContentValues * string * string[] -> int

Parametri

uri
Uri

URI da modificare.

values
ContentValues

I nuovi valori di campo. La chiave è il nome della colonna per il campo. Un valore Null rimuoverà un valore di campo esistente.

where
String

Filtro da applicare alle righe prima dell'aggiornamento, formattato come clausola SQL WHERE (escluso il WHERE stesso).

selectionArgs
String[]

Restituisce

numero di righe aggiornate.

Attributi

Eccezioni

se l'URI o i valori sono Null

Commenti

Aggiornare le righe in un URI del contenuto.

Se il provider di contenuto supporta le transazioni, l'aggiornamento sarà atomico.

Documentazione Java per android.content.ContentResolver.update(android.net.Uri, android.content.ContentValues, java.lang.String, java.lang.String[]).

Le parti di questa pagina sono modifiche in base al lavoro creato e condiviso dal Android Open Source e usato in base ai termini descritti nella .

Si applica a